DescriptionPaperclips is a revolutionary tool designed to help students and learners easily create flashcards from course notes or any website. With its two major features, Paperclips Web and Paperclips Copilot, users can generate high-quality flashcards in any language, directly from their notes or the internet. The platform also supports exporting flashcards to popular formats like Anki, Quizlet, PDF, and CSV. Available as a Chrome extension, Paperclips simplifies the process of creating and managing study materials, making it an indispensable tool for anyone looking to accelerate their learning journey.FlashFlashCards is a versatile app designed to streamline the process of creating educational flashcards. By converting screenshots of websites or PDFs into flashcards and integrating them automatically into Anki, it helps users save time. The app also supports generating flashcards from pasted text and leverages advanced LLM technology, similar to ChatGPT, to simplify learning with Anki. Currently in beta, FlashFlashCards is available for both Mac and Windows under a 'pay what you want' model.
